Helen Erfle Obituary

ERFLE HELEN C. (nee Costello), April 10, 2003, 91, of Holland, formerly of Phila; beloved wife of the late Raymond J. Erfle Sr.; dearest mother and mother-in-law of Raymond J. Jr. and Elizabeth Erfle, Paul David and Kathy Erfle, Mary Ruth Erfle,Elizabeth Helen and William Magill. She is also survived by her 13 grandchildren and 6 great grandchildren to whom she was a shining example. Relatives and friends are invited to attend her Funeral on Tuesday from 10 A.M. until her Funeral Mass at 11 A.M. at St. Bede the Venerable Church, 1071 Holland Rd, Holland. Int. Fernwood Cemetery, Upper Darby PA. In lieu of flowers, Mass Cards or Contributions in her memory may be made to John M. Hallahan Girls High School, 311 N. 19th St, Phila PA 19103 would be appreciated. Arr. JOSEPH A. FLUEHR III F.H., Richboro
